JAIRM: Call for Papers Open

Journal of Airport Management and Airline has opened the papers submissions to be published in the next regular issue with the system Dynamic Journal Issue.

JAIRM

Through this system, and always faithful to Open Access policy, JAIRM will immediately publish accepted articles in our website. As soon as the manuscript is accepted, it will be published online in the open issue. In the publishing date, we will proceed to close the online issue, and publish its printed version. Thus, authors with accepted manuscripts will promptly see them being part of the current Dynamic Journal Issue of JAIRM, skipping the usual waiting times in traditional publication systems. This system speeds up the impact of authors’ contribution, bringing the possibility of citing the article in future research as soon as it is accepted by our reviewers. Throughout this system we aim to foster the spread of scientific knowledge, making our accepted and validated contributions available even before the issue closing.

Welcome to the inaugural issue of Journal of Airline and Airport Management (JAIRM)

We are pleased to introduce this first and inaugural issue of the first volume of the Journal of Airline and Airport Management (JAIRM). JAIRM is an international journal that proposes and fosters discussion on the theory and application in all areas of air transport, including (but not limited to) air transport and globalization, airline and airport management. We are interested in issues related to production, logistics, operations, marketing, policy and regulation, information systems, project management, quality, as well as regional development, economics, organizational behaviour, finance and accounting in air transport research.
